Description |
United States Navy fleet tug USS Wandank (AT-26) (eft) and submarine rescue vessel USS Falcon (ASR-2) (right) ca. 24 May 1939, with the McCann Rescue Chamber between them, during operations to rescue the crew of sunken submarine USS Squalus (SS-192) |
